Understanding Cold Wallets

What Are Cold Wallets?

Cold wallets, or cold storage, refer to offline cryptocurrency storage methods. They are not connected to the internet, making them immune to online hacking attempts and malware. The two primary forms of cold wallets are hardware wallets and paper wallets.

Hardware wallets like Ledger or Trezor provide a highly secure way to store cryptocurrencies. They keep your private keys offline and require a physical device for transaction verification.

Paper wallets, on the other hand, are a more basic form of cold storage. They involve printing your public and private keys on paper. While effective, they require careful handling to prevent physical loss or damage.

Cold wallets are ideal for longterm storage, typically for users who wish to safely guard their assets without the intent to make frequent transactions.

Why Use Cold Wallets?

The advantages of cold wallets include:

  • Enhanced Security: Since they are offline, cold wallets drastically reduce the risk of hacking and unauthorized access.
  • Longterm Storage: Users who plan on holding their assets without immediate transactions benefit from the stability of cold wallets.
  • Control Over Private Keys: Cold wallets ensure users have complete control over their private keys, enhancing asset ownership.
